The Weeknd - 10 things to know with detail
  • Real Name: The Weeknd's real name is Abel Tesfaye. He was born on February 16, 1990, in Toronto, Ontario, Canada.
  • Musical Style: The Weeknd is known for his unique blend of R&B, pop, and electronic music. His music often features dark and moody production, with introspective lyrics about love, relationships, and inner demons.
  • Rise to Fame: The Weeknd first gained attention in 2011 with the release of his mixtapes "House of Balloons," "Thursday," and "Echoes of Silence." He quickly gained a following for his distinctive sound and cryptic persona.
  • Breakout Album: The Weeknd's debut studio album, "Kiss Land," was released in 2013 and received critical acclaim. It featured hit singles like "Belong to the World" and "Live For."
  • Chart-Topping Success: The Weeknd achieved mainstream success with his second studio album, "Beauty Behind the Madness," which was released in 2015. The album spawned hit singles like "Can't Feel My Face" and "The Hills," and earned him two Grammy Awards.
  • Collaborations: The Weeknd has collaborated with a number of artists throughout his career, including Drake, Ariana Grande, Lana Del Rey, and Kendrick Lamar.
  • Super Bowl Halftime Show: The Weeknd headlined the Super Bowl LV halftime show in 2021, delivering a high-energy performance that featured hits like "Blinding Lights" and "Save Your Tears."
  • Awards and Accolades: The Weeknd has won numerous awards throughout his career, including three Grammy Awards, nine Billboard Music Awards, and two American Music Awards.
  • Acting Career: In addition to his music career, The Weeknd has also dabbled in acting. He made his acting debut in the 2019 film "Uncut Gems," starring alongside Adam Sandler.
  • Philanthropy: The Weeknd is known for his philanthropic efforts, particularly in the areas of racial justice and healthcare. In 2020, he donated $500,000 to organizations supporting the Black Lives Matter movement and $1 million to COVID-19 relief efforts.
